Abstract

The utility model discloses a mechanical hopper plate turnover device for a spreading machine and a spreading machine, belonging to the field of spreading machine parts, comprising a plate turnover device body, wherein the plate turnover device body is connected at the front ends of a left hopper and a right hopper, the front end of a scraping bottom plate is fixedly connected with a cover plate, the plate turnover device body comprises a main turning plate, a first articulated shaft, a left turning plate, a right turning plate, a left connecting piece, a right connecting piece, a left fixing plate, a left articulated shaft, a right fixing plate, a right articulated shaft, a left limiting rod and a right limiting rod, the main turning plate is articulated on the cover plate at the front end of the scraping bottom plate through the first articulated shaft, the left turning plate is rotationally connected at the front end of the left hopper, and; a paver. Background
The receiving system of the paver comprises a pushing roller, a left hopper, a right hopper and a scraping bottom plate. The pushing idler wheel of the paver contacts with the rear wheel of the tripper to enable the tripper to advance along with the paver, the tripper unloads paving materials into the hopper through the inclination of the carriage, and the paving materials are conveyed to the spiral distributing device on the rear side of the paver by the scraper to be fed to the screed for paving the pavement, wherein the paving materials have higher temperature so as to be bonded and compacted when being pressed on a road. The spreading materials in the scraping bottom plate are gradually reduced along with the continuous forward spreading of the spreading machine, in order to ensure continuous feeding, the hoppers on two sides can be closed to enable the spreading materials in the hoppers to slide into the scraping bottom plate, the sliding part of the spreading materials is accumulated on a cover plate at the front end of the scraping bottom plate, and the spreading materials on the cover plate cannot be conveyed backwards into the scraping bottom plate and can only be manually shoveled into the scraping bottom plate due to the fixed cover plate, so that the time and the labor are wasted, and the utilization rate of the spreading materials is reduced; in addition, because the hopper opens and shuts repeatedly and leads to the high temperature spreading material on the fixed apron more and more, the high temperature spreading material can produce the temperature segregation along with the temperature reduction, solidifies in addition and is difficult to the clearance on the apron, and the manual work is thrown the spreading material to the in-process of scraping the material bottom plate with spreading the material shovel and is raised the spreading material, makes the spreading material produce certain material segregation, and temperature segregation and material segregation are huge to road surface construction quality influence. Detailed Description
In order to make the objects, technical solutions and advantages of the present invention more apparent, the present invention is further described in detail with reference to the following embodiments. It should be understood that the specific embodiments described herein are merely illustrative of the invention and are not intended to limit the invention.
The utility model discloses a mechanical type hopper plate turnover and paver for paver reduce to spread the material and pile up on plate turnover, and plate turnover rotates with the hopper in step, and the material that spreads out can be along with plate turnover machinery rotates the slip in the scraper bottom plate. For further explanation of the present invention, reference will be made to the following detailed description taken in conjunction with the accompanying drawings:
a mechanical hopper flap device for a paver comprises a flap device body 1, wherein the flap device body 1 is connected to the front ends of a left hopper 12 and a right hopper 13 of the paver, the left hopper 12 and the right hopper 13 are positioned on two sides of a scraping bottom plate 11 of the paver, the front end of the scraping bottom plate 11 is fixedly connected with a cover plate 14, the flap device body 1 comprises a main flap 2, a first hinge shaft 21, a left flap 3, a right flap 4, a left connecting piece 5, a right connecting piece 6, a left fixing plate 33, a left hinge shaft 34, a right fixing plate 43, a right hinge shaft 44, a left limiting rod 35 and a right limiting rod 45, and the main flap 2 is hinged to the front end of the scraping bottom plate 11 through the first hinge shaft 21 and above the cover plate 14; the front end of the left hopper 12 is fixedly connected with the left fixing plate 33, the left turning plate 3 is hinged with the left fixing plate 33 through the left hinge shaft 34 so as to be connected with the front end of the left hopper 12, a left limiting rod 35 is fixedly connected below the right end of the left turning plate 3 along the right end of the left turning plate 3, and the left turning plate 3 is lapped above the main turning plate 2 through the left limiting rod 35; the front end of the right hopper 13 is fixedly connected with the right fixing plate 43, the right turning plate 4 is hinged with the right fixing plate 43 through the right hinge shaft 44 and is connected with the front end of the right hopper 13, a right limiting rod 45 is fixedly connected below the left end of the right turning plate 4 along the left end of the right turning plate 4, and the right turning plate 4 is lapped above the main turning plate 2 through the right limiting rod 45; the two ends of the left side connecting piece 5 are respectively connected with the left side hopper 12 and the main turning plate 2, the two ends of the right side connecting piece 6 are respectively connected with the right side hopper 13 and the main turning plate 2, and the left side hopper 12 pulls the main turning plate 2 through the left side connecting piece 5 and the right side hopper 13 through the right side connecting piece 6.

Further, the arrangement of the left fixing plate 33 and the right fixing plate 43 improves the welding precision and the connection firmness with the left hopper 12 and the right hopper 13. The left side gag lever post 35 shape turns over board 3 and the main clearance phase-match between the board 2 that turns over with the left side, and the right side gag lever post 45 shape turns over board 4 and the main clearance phase-match between the board 2 that turns over with the right side, effectively prevents that the main board 2, the left side from turning over the board 3 and the right side turns over 4 upper portions of board and spread the leakage of bed material to make the left side turn over board 3 and the right side turn over board 4 along with the main rotation backward rotation that turns over. The left limiting rod 35 and the right limiting rod 45 are respectively connected with the turning plates at the two sides in a welding mode, a fastening piece connecting mode and the like, the materials can be plain carbon steel or high-quality carbon steel, the wear resistance of the steel is improved after heat treatment, the processing and the manufacturing are convenient, and the cost is reduced.
In the above technical solution, preferably, the left connecting member 5 is a left lifting chain 51, the lower end of the left side plate of the left hopper 12 near the main turning plate 2 is provided with a first mounting seat 52 and a first lock catch 53 matched with the first mounting seat, the left end of the main turning plate 2 near the left side plate is provided with a second mounting seat 54 and a second lock catch 55 matched with the second mounting seat, and two ends of the left lifting chain 51 are respectively connected to the first lock catch 53 and the second lock catch 55; the right connecting piece 6 adopts a right lifting chain 61, a third mounting seat 62 and a third lock catch 63 matched with the third mounting seat are arranged at the lower end of the right side plate of the right hopper 13 close to the side of the main turning plate 2, a fourth mounting seat 64 and a fourth lock catch 65 matched with the fourth mounting seat are arranged at the right end of the main turning plate 2 close to the side of the right side plate, and two ends of the right lifting chain 61 are respectively connected with the third lock catch 63 and the fourth lock catch 65. In this embodiment, the selection of the installation positions of the first, second, third and fourth installation seats 52, 54, 62 and 64 can avoid the interference between the left and right lifting chains 51 and 61 and other parts of the apparatus. Left side hopper 12 and right side hopper 13 drive main board 2 synchronous backward rotation through left side lifting chain 51 and right side lifting chain 61 when opening and shutting and rotate, lead to the material of spreading to leak when avoiding the maloperation, adopt the lifting chain length of being convenient for adjust, and then conveniently satisfy the main requirement of turning over the board different angles of upset. Further, the left-side hoist chain 51 and the right-side hoist chain 61 are subjected to plating rust prevention treatment, and materials meeting the strength requirement can be selected according to the load. The design structure is simple, the cost is saved, the maintenance is convenient, and the occupied space is small. Wherein, left side lifting chain 51 and right side lifting chain 61 can adopt the iron chain, satisfy the use strength requirement, and reduce cost, the purchase of being convenient for.
In the above technical solution, preferably, a front end rubber plate 22 is arranged along the front end surface of the main turning plate 2, and a front end attachment plate 23 is arranged in front of the front end rubber plate 22; a left rubber plate 31 is arranged along the front end face of the left turning plate 3, and a left attachment plate 32 is arranged at the front part of the left rubber plate 31; a right rubber plate 41 is arranged along the front end face of the right turning plate 4, and a right attachment plate 42 is arranged in front of the right rubber plate 41. In the technical scheme, a front-end rubber plate 22 is fixedly connected to a main turning plate 2 through a front-end attachment plate 23, a left-side rubber plate 31 is fixedly connected to a left-side turning plate 3 through a left-side attachment plate 32, a right-side rubber plate 41 is fixedly connected to a right-side turning plate 4 through a right-side attachment plate 42, the front-end rubber plate 22, the left-side rubber plate 31 and the right-side rubber plate 41 can respectively prevent paving materials from leaking to the ground from mounting positions of the front-end rubber plate 22, the left-side rubber plate 31 and the right-side rubber plate 41, and a rubber material is adopted to facilitate the extension of a carriage of a tripper with a; the front-end flitch 23, the left flitch 32 and the right flitch 42 are respectively connected on the plate turnover device by fasteners, all adopt carbon steel materials, play the role of fixing rubber plates and can prevent the rubber plates from being damaged.
